"Socialism is a philosophy of failure, the creed of ignorance, and the gospel of envy, its inherent virtue is the equal sharing of misery"
About this Quote
The subtext is anxiety about modernity’s redistributionist promises, and about the postwar mood that made those promises politically potent. Churchill had to argue against a rising consensus that the state could and should engineer equality after the shared sacrifices of WWII. His counter is to redefine equality as a trap: not shared prosperity, but “the equal sharing of misery.” It’s a brilliantly cruel inversion, taking socialism’s moral claim - fairness - and painting it as a leveling down fueled by resentment.
Context sharpens the intent. In mid-century Britain, “socialism” often meant Labour’s expanding welfare state, nationalizations, and planning. Churchill collapses those specific programs into a single moral pathology. The line works because it offers emotional clarity amid complex economics: if you’re worried about rationing, bureaucracy, and stagnation, he gives you a villain with motives you can despise. It’s rhetoric as inoculation, aiming to make the very desire for redistribution feel petty, even sinful, before the debate starts.
